I used Concord & 9th’s Yuletide Ornament stamps and the matching Yuletide dies for the focal image on this card. I stamped the ornament on water colour card with Versafine Onyx Black ink and heat embossed with clear powder. I spritzed the ornament with water and clear shimmer sprays and used a brush to add shades of pink and purple inks. Once dry, I cut out the ornament and layered it onto two more plain white die cut ornaments. Initially, I was going to have a plain background, but decided to create a text background instead. I used stamps from Concord & 9th Big On Christmas stamps, MFT Itty Bitty Holiday stamps, and C&9 Yuletide Ornament. I adhered the yuletide ornament to the card and finished the front with a bold Christmas sentiment from Yuletide Ornaments and cut out with the matching die.
Inside the card I cut a mat layer of pink card. On the white panel I stamped the pretty ornament in a soft pink ink. I finished the inside by adding a greeting in black ink – this one came from Yuletide Ornament.
This card features the holly sprig from C&9 Yuletide Ornament stamp set. I stamped the holly on white card, coloured with Copic markers and then restamped all with Versamark ink and heat embossed with gold powder. I used the matching die from Yuletide Ornament die set to cut out the coloured images, along with several plain white dies. I layered the top two holly sprigs on two more die cut layers. I created the background panel by stamping the little snowflake stamps from Lawn Fawn’s Giant Holiday Messages stamp set. I used Versamark ink and heat embossed with clear powder. I used several shades of blue and green to blend over the panel and reveal the snowflake background. I cut the panel to 3” x 5½” and adhered to the right side of the A2 notecard base. I made the gold trim by rubbing Versamark ink onto white card and heat embossing with gold powder. I did this process twice to give a nice smooth gold panel. I trimmed a ½” wide and adhered that to the side of the snowflake panel. I adhered the layered holly sprigs to the top and middle and added the single layer holly sprig at the bottom. I finished the front with a sentiment from C&9 Yuletide Ornament, stamped in Versafine Onyx Black ink and heat embossed with clear powder. I used the matching die from Yuletide Ornament die set to cut out the sentiment along with three white dies, which I layered together.
Inside the card, I cut a mat layer of pale aqua card. On the white panel I stamped one of the large sentiments from Lawn Fawn’s Giant Holiday Messages. I used Copic markers to colour the leaves and open letters, restamped with Versafine Onyx Black ink and heat embossed with clear powder.
